Appointment Letters handed over to girl trainees of Govt ITI (w) Mohali

Vocational education a boon for building a better future: Shamsher Singh Purkhalvi

10 girl trainees of Sewing Technology and Surface Ornamentation Techniques trade of Government Industrial Training Institute (w), Mohali at Phase 5 have been selected for the job during the campus interview and given an annual package of Rs. 1.5 lakh by the company.In a written statement issued to the media by the organization, the District Nodal Officer and Principal of ITI(w) Mohali Mr. Shamsher Purkhalvi said that the local Messrs. Virsa Clothing Company has selected 10 girls who have been given letters of appointment for regular employment after one month of practical training. He said that besides the salary, the company has also agreed to provide many other facilities to the newly selected girls. Mr. Purkhalvi said that handicraft education has an important role to play in the present times by which all the challenges faced can be easily tackled. He said that all out efforts are being made by the entire staff to create employment opportunities for all the trainees related to various trades of the institute after the course so that the girls could become a stable and lasting support to their family after their training. He appealed to the parents to provide vocational education to their daughters for building a better future so that they could become self reliant as well as support their families.The girl trainees selected by the company expressed their happiness and special thanks to the officials of the institute and the officials of department for their efforts in enabling them to earn a living today.
